How to Identify the Right Storage Type for Your Needs
Understanding the available types is the first step to finding the right storage. Here are some typical storage service options to consider:
• Rentable self-storage units allow easy, secure access and management for both personal and business use.
• Household Storage Services: Perfect for homeowners looking to store furniture, seasonal items, or personal belongings during a move or renovation.
• Companies benefit from business storage for organised, secure inventory and equipment solutions.
• Big operations turn to warehouses for bulk items and heavy-duty equipment storage.
• Specialty furniture storage uses padding and climate control to keep large items safe.
By reviewing these choices, you can narrow down which storage type suits your goals.
What to Look for in a Storage Facility
Consider these elements to ensure your chosen facility meets your needs:
1. Matching Your Storage Type to Your Items
The items you plan to store will dictate the type of storage services you need. For instance:
• Large items like sofas or tables often need padded, climate-regulated storage.
• Personal storage is often suited to smaller units for boxes and seasonal belongings.
• For sensitive files or electronics, businesses should choose regulated storage.
Decide based on how fragile, costly, or sizable the stored goods will be.
2. Location and Accessibility
The right location can make storage far more practical and cost-effective. Consider:
• Being close to your base saves time and transportation costs.
• 24/7 access lets you reach your storage whenever necessary.
• Security measures like monitoring and gates reduce theft risks.
Business users should prioritise sites that minimise logistical delays.
3. Planning for Present and Future Storage Needs
Pick a size that fits now but can adapt to future growth. Most providers offer a range of sizes, from tiny to industrial-scale units. Plan for:
• Your immediate needs as well as growth over time.
• Options for moving to bigger or smaller units easily.
For furniture storage, ensure the unit can accommodate bulky items without cramming.
4. Climate Control and Protection
To protect valuables, regulated storage helps avoid warping, rust, and decay. For valuables, choose facilities that offer:
• Controlled climate conditions.
• Pest control measures.
• Insurance offerings for peace of mind.
5. Finding Affordable Storage Solutions
Storage rates differ based on features, size, and facility location. To keep costs down:
• Compare rates from multiple storage facilities.
• Check for specials on long-term or new-user plans.
• Factor in additional costs like insurance or access fees.
Cost should be considered relative to efficiency improvements for businesses.
6. Why Security Should Be a Priority
A secure facility is essential when leaving valuables in storage. Seek:
• Constant video monitoring and staff presence.
• Individual unit alarms or locks.
• Access control through gates and individual codes.
Corporate storage users need extra protection for valuable assets.
7. Contract Flexibility
Choose a provider offering contracts suitable for varying time frames. Look for:
• Contracts that renew monthly for easier management.
• Easy-to-understand cancellation rules.
• Switching between unit sizes without penalties.
